    When running iTunes 7.1 along with games in order to play my own music in the background (specifically Elder Scrolls IV: Oblivion but presumably any game with significant usage of EAX or 3D sound hardware capabilities), my sound card's output becomes garbled (but only for the game's output, not iTunes') and shortly after my computer either freezes or experiences a MACHINECHECKEXCEPTION blue screen of death. The only other game I have installed - The Sims 2 - does not cause this problem, but it probably isn't as taxing on audio hardware.
    You can listen to the (fatal) glitch here if you're interested: http://www.supload.com/listen?s=S7n1x01E_1X
    The reason I am coming here instead of a Creative forum is that the problem was introduced with iTunes 7.1 and will not occur with any previous version or any other audio-playing software I've tried.
    I have a Creative Sound Blaster Audigy 2 ZS, and the problem is limited to this card, meaning it doesn't happen with my onboard sound, but the problem was introduced with iTunes 7.1. I've uninstalled and put version 7 (no .1) back on to make sure and the problem would not occur.
    Also, it seems to be limited to having high-quality audio options set in the QuickTime Preferences. It only seems to happen when I have 48kHz as the sampling rate and 24-bit as the size. Using "Safe mode" will have no effect; the problem occurs with or without using waveOut.
    I almost scrapped my sound card until I decided to diagnose the problem further and discovered it was limited to iTunes 7.1.
    I hope this problem is solved in future versions of iTunes, but since - I'll admit - it seems fairly obscure, I'll probably be forced to stay one version below 7.1 from now on or (Gosh-forbid) lower the quality settings for now.
    So some steps to reproduce the problem (if you have a Creative Sound Blaster card (one that supports 24-bit which is most new or decent ones) I'd appreciate you confirming this issue) are:
    1. Open QuickTime Player. Click Edit > Preferences > QuickTime Preferences. Click the Audio tab and change the Rate to 48 kHz if it isn't there already. Change the Size to 24 bit from 16 bit. Channels doesn't seem to have any effect on this issue so leave it alone. Click OK and exit QuickTime player.
    2. Now go ahead and open iTunes and start playing some music.
    3. Try playing any game you have that takes a decent toll on your sound card's abilities (Oblivion should cut it if you have it; I haven't tried World of Warcraft but I'd reckon that in a busy area the problem would occur in it as well).
    4. Enter an area with a lot of noises, or start battling or something.
    And a temporary workaround:
    1. Just change the Size back to 16 bit, or lower the Rate to 44.1 kHz, and the problem should go away.

    If your sound is crashing "system wide" your problems are deeper (a lot deeper) than Flash Player.
    Make sure you have your Windows 7 DVD.
    Click Start and Run (if the Run Command isn't in your Start Menu, you can add it by right clicking the Start button and choosing Properties, then go to Start Menu and Customize.
    In the Run window type "sfc /scannow" minus the quotes, of course. That's ess eff see space slashscannow exactly as it appears between the quotes.
    This will start the Windows System File Checker (SFC) and will scan your OS to ensure all necessary system files are intact and uncorrupted.
    It may ask for the Windows 7 DVD if it finds something it cannot repair, so you need to have it handy.

    Anyhow, since you had it working before with iMovie 11, I am suspecting that it somehow got corrupted when the mounted volume (your camera) somehow got disconnected due to inadequate battery power.  Which was why Canon recommended people use an AC adapter for this or a fresh battery before a major transfer of movie clips.  When mounted volumes disconnect abruptly for whatever reasons, iMovie 11 goes into beserk mode trying to restore that connection resulting in crashes or slowdowns.
    To restore iMovie 11 back to where it was.
    You need to delete iMovie's plist and cache files, 2 files located in your Home/Libary folder
    com.apple.iMovieapp.plist (document)
    com.apple.iMovieapp        (folder)
    After this, you can either do 2 things.  One is run disk repair utility and execute repair permissions on the drive that iMovie resides (probably your main boot drive) or download a free utility called OnyX which is a free OSX maintenance software to do that plus some extras including clearing caches, which sometimes are the causes of system crashes. 
    It is available from http://www.titanium.free.fr/index.php and it will help repair permissions and clear caches.  Please download the appropriate version for your OSX (Snow Leopard).
    Once that is done, reboot your computer and run iMovie 11.  Connect the cable to the camera and computer and do your import.  Make sure you have a fresh charged battery on your Canon.  This should work.
